Andy and Melissa Bennington-Turner are professional creators and mariners who have documented a decade-long transition from minimalist weekend sailing to a high-authority liveaboard existence. Aboard their 46-foot sailing yacht, Ocean Melody, the family has established a world-proven reference for "Slow Sailing" and technical systems forensics. In 2026, the mission has evolved into a "Factory Reset" chapter in North Wales, where the family is balancing a professional-grade bulkhead-up refit with the complex logistics of caring for aging parents and raising their two sons, Jack and Ollie.

Andy and Melissa Bennington-Turner are a British sailing couple documenting their life aboard Ocean Melody with their two sons.
Ocean Melody is a 46-foot sailing yacht currently undergoing a comprehensive structural and systems refit in North Wales.
As of June 2026, the family is based in the Menai Straits, North Wales, focused on their 'Factory Reset' refit chapter.
It is their 2026 mission to gut their 46ft yacht to the bulkheads for a professional refit while managing family health responsibilities on land.
The family has progressed through three vessels: a 24ft Snapdragon, a 38ft steel cutter (Melody), and their current 46ft yacht (Ocean Melody).
Andy is a professional musician, media director, and former paramedic with extensive experience in technical boat systems.
In 2026, the crew integrated a high-capacity EcoFlow Lithium energy stack to support their remote liveaboard requirements.
Jack and Ollie are Andy and Melissa's sons. Jack is a central part of their 'slow sailing' philosophy, and Ollie was born during their refit journey.
The refit is funded through their Patreon community, YouTube revenue, and Andy's professional work in media and music production.
